Facey Medical Group Awarded $1.2 Million From Pay-for-Performance Program; Facey Receives Top Honors From Blue Cross of California
Posted on: Monday, 22 August 2005, 15:00 CDT
Blue Cross of California has named Facey Medical Group as the top-performing medical group in Southern California, awarding physicians with $1.2 million in pay-for-performance bonuses based on their 2004 Quality Performance Scorecard.

In 2003, Facey Medical Group physicians deployed TouchWorks(TM) Electronic Health Record from Allscripts (Nasdaq: MDRX) to its 120 primary care and specialty physicians. It has played a major role in Facey's high performance rating and pay-for-performance award from Blue Cross. This award and pay-for-performance bonus is based on achievements Facey Medical Group accomplished in 2004. The Blue Cross evaluation process monitored participating physician groups for their efforts in improving the quality of care provided to HMO patients.
Blue Cross's Quality Performance Scorecard is one of many Pay-for-Performance initiatives. Another example of pay-for-performance is the Center for Medicare and Medicaid Services (CMS) pay-for-performance pilot program. The program's goal is to demonstrate whether paying financial incentives to physicians who use information technologies such as the Electronic Health Record (EHR) can lower the nation's annual $290 billion Medicare tab while improving patient outcomes.

About Facey Medical Group
Based in Mission Hills, California, Facey Medical Group is the area's leading healthcare organization with more than 120 board-certified primary care and specialty physicians dedicated to providing quality medical services to residents of the San Fernando, Santa Clarita and San Gabriel valleys.
